Back to Forever

A lifetime journey.

I would have forever
remained in stillness
somewhere between here
and a nebulous there,
no name to whisper
and no breath to bear.

I was the morning mist
clinging to the seaside rocks.
I drifted ephemerally
at water's edge,
then disappeared quickly
as the sun began to rise.

Something lured me out
from behind the safe shadows
with tantalizing promises
of this great thing called living.

Here I see love embodied.
Here I feel the blood moving.
Here I celebrate the gift
of my life incarnate.

Yet when I am still
I can almost remember
the path back to forever.
